Lucknow, Karampur in state hockey final
Hosts and defending champions Lucknow and favourites Karampur stormed into the final of the State Under-14 Boys Hockey Tournament, registering convincing wins, at the KD Singh ‘Babu’ Stadium here on Monday.
Lucknow crushed Ghazipur 8-3 after leading by 3-2 at the break, whereas Karampur brushed aside Etawah 4-1 after being locked at 1-1 at the half-time. S Ali continued with his good run for Lucknow as he struck three goals, including the first one in the eighth minute. Akash Yadav scored a brace, Divyanshu Sharma, Alok Mishra and Zahid shared three goals between them.
For Ghazipur, Akash Pal sounded the board twice, while Krishna Mohan scored one goal.
Ajeet and Manoj were the start perfor mers for Karampur in the second semi-final as they scored two goals each. Nitish struck the consolation goal for Etawah.
On Tuesday, final starts at 2.30 p.m., but before that Ghazipur will take on Etawah in the hard-line match at 1.30 p.m. The winners would be fetching Rs 2.5 lakh, whereas second and third place holders would be richer by Rs 2 lakh and Rs 1.5 lakh, respectively. THRILLING VICTORY

Sacred Heart and State United notched up contrasting wins in the 19th Mansarovar Cup Football Tournament here on Monday. Sacred Heart trounced Euro FC by 5-0, whereas State United defeated Milani Football Club by 2-0. FOOTBALL TRIAL
Trials to pick up district junior boys football team will be held on December 23, at the Chowk Stadium here at 3.00 p.m. This will be followed by the regional trials on December 24, whereas the finally selected players will participate in the state championship to be held at Faizabad from January 6.
